I have an update... First thanks to the DIRT member who looked into it and gave me an answer rather than the CSR's who didnt know what was going on. The upgrade is only available to subscibers who have Americas 200 package or better, have no current contract obligations, and heres the kicker... a good payment history. If you have paid late (which I have) you may not be eligable.
